SolGen should ask SC review of fugitive disentitlement policy in Zaldy Co, Atong Ang cases, says Lacson

State lawyers may ask for a review of the Supreme Court’s “fugitive disentitlement doctrine” to help them further limit the legal options of absconders like former party-list lawmaker Elizaldy “Zaldy” Co and businessman Charlie “Atong” Ang.

Senate President Pro Tempore Panfilo “Ping” Lacson pointed this out on Friday, January 29 after Co's camp claimed the doctrine does not apply to him.

The said doctrine is embodied in the Supreme Court's Nov. 25, 2025 ruling (GR 259337), which clarifies the rules on fugitive status and barring them from judicial relief unless conditions are satisfied.

“Paging SolGen (Solicitor General): It may be wise to ask the Court to revisit the ‘fugitive disentitlement doctrine’ in GR 259337 dtd Nov. 25, 2025 that refined Miranda vs Tuliao in relation to the cases of Zaldy Co and Atong Ang,” Lacson said on his post on X.

Authorities, including the Senate Blue Ribbon Committee, which Lacson chairs, have been seeking for Co in relation to the anomalous flood control projects.

Ang, on the other hand, is being tracked down in relation to the case of the missing cock fighters (sabungeros).

Co's camp, in challenging the Ombudsman's resolution that led to the filing of graft and malversation charges against him, claimed the fugitive disentitlement doctrine should not apply to his Sandiganbayan cases.

They argued that judgment has not been rendered against Co, who is now in Sweden, "so he is not an appellant; neither is he an escapee or bail jumper."

In a Dec. 10, 2025 resolution, the Sandiganbayan declared Co a "fugitive from justice."

In its November 2025 ruling, the Supreme Court created an exception to Miranda vs. Tuliao (G.R. No. 158763, March 31, 2006) allowing individuals to seek affirmative relief in criminal cases while staying outside the reach of Philippine courts - when the accused is a fugitive from justice.

Based on this ruling, a fugitive from justice is someone "who not only flees after conviction to avoid punishment, but one who also flees after being charged to avoid prosecution," adding that "the essential element is the intent to evade prosecution or punishment."

Under the ruling, if there is a failure to execute the warrant of arrest by reason that the accused is outside the Philippine jurisdiction, as stated in the executing officer’s return, the court may, either by motion or motu proprio, and after assessment of the circumstances of the case, declare the accused a fugitive from justice.

“From then, such person loses their standing in court, can no longer participate in the proceedings, and seek any judicial relief. They can only restore their standing before the court through voluntary surrender,” it said.

In such cases, it said that jurisdiction over the person of the accused is not acquired simply by the filing of pleadings or participation through counsel.

“Custody over the person of the accused, whether through arrest or voluntary surrender, must first be obtained before the case may proceed,” it said.
